Books I used

My theory was to buy a book for adults and one for teaching kids. I thought that if the adult book was too confusing that the kids book would clear it up...I was right.  Here are the two books I used and they worked great!

Teach Me To Crochet

Boye "I Taught Myself to Crochet" Kit
